Subject: Loyalty ledger cut-over complete

The migration of the Perkstone loyalty-points ledger from the legacy Tallyhouse system finished overnight with zero reconciliation mismatches. Dual-write mode is now disabled and reads are served entirely from the new ledger. For your security review, the service configuration as deployed in production is reproduced below.

settings of fafog-haduf:
ZORIX_PIN=4648
ZORIX_METRICS_HOST=metrics.zorix.paliqsys.corp
ZORIX_LOG_LEVEL=info
ZORIX_TENANT=druix

Subject: Garage feed v2 live

Hello all — the Stallhaven occupancy feed for the Merrow Street garages is now publishing on the v2 topic. New team members: v1 stays up for two weeks, then sunsets. Polling consumers should move to the push stream; it updates every 30 seconds instead of five minutes. The deploy that shipped this carries the token below.

pipeline stamp: htk6_35e0c9

**Tuning: planner regression in Quernlite**

After the v9 upgrade, Quernlite's planner started picking nested-loop joins on wide tenant tables, tanking report queries. Workaround until the fix lands: raise the row-estimate floor and bias toward hash joins via the knobs below. Don't touch anything else in `planner.conf` — the Harwick team owns the rest. Restart the coordinator after edits. Recommended values follow.

tuning table, kajog-kawef:
PRIORITIES = {
    "kelox": 870,
    "kasix": 89,
    "eliax": 988,
}

# Break-Glass: Catalog Cache Invalidation

Scope: the Pinrow product catalog at Veldstone Retail. If stale prices persist after a purge and the Hollowmere invalidation queue is wedged, use break-glass to flush the edge tier directly. Contractors: get verbal sign-off from the catalog lead first. Steps: open the Hollowmere admin shell, select emergency-flush, confirm the tenant, and run it once — repeated flushes thrash the origin. Access is logged and expires after 20 minutes. Unseal the admin shell with the passphrase below.

recovery phrase for kahop-tajog: istix-casvan